07.01.2022 Archer River is making it a wee bit difficult to explore the Cape by car right now - there is a road under there somewhere I promise! Luckily Skytrans fly from Cairns to Lockhart River once per day Monday to Friday. So, you can still experience the cape at what we like to think is the best time of year :)

01.01.2022 This is the tiny township of Portland Roads. It's about a 30 minute drive from the Greenhoose and it's where you'll find our beach house "The Bluehoose". The area is an amazing spot to launch your boat for a day out fishing the reef. It's also just a 5 minute drive from the iconic Chilli Beach or to use as a base for wildlife spotting trips!
